Can Figure 8 Puffer Fish Survive in Freshwater?

No, Figure 8 puffer fish cannot survive in freshwater. They require brackish water, which is a mixture of freshwater and saltwater.

Figure 8 puffer fish thrive in environments with specific salinity levels. Their bodies are adapted to handle brackish water conditions, which have lower salt content than ocean water but higher than freshwater. Without the appropriate salinity, their osmoregulation, which is the process of maintaining fluid balance, becomes ineffective. This leads to stress, health decline, and ultimately death if they are kept in purely freshwater conditions.

  5. Maintain Salinity Levels: Maintaining salinity levels refers to keeping the water in a brackish state, which is crucial for Figure 8 Puffer Fish. A salinity of 1.005 to 1.015 specific gravity is recommended. Salinity can be monitored using a hydrometer. According to aquatic expert J. Smith (2018), incorrect salinity levels can cause stress and lead to disease.

  3. Maintain Stable Water Conditions:
    Maintaining stable water conditions is vital for the health of Figure 8 Puffer Fish. These fish prefer brackish water with a specific gravity between 1.005 and 1.015. Consistent water temperatures between 74°F and 82°F are also important. Regular water testing for ammonia, nitrites, and nitrates helps ensure a healthy environment. Fluctuations can lead to stress and illness, affecting all species in the tank. Following these parameters helps combat potential disease.

  4. Ensure a Proper Diet:
    Ensuring a proper diet is critical for the nutritional needs of Figure 8 Puffer Fish. These fish are omnivorous and thrive on a balanced diet. Feed them high-quality pellets, frozen or live food such as brine shrimp and snails. A varied diet supports their health and prevents nutritional deficiencies. Additionally, feeding snails can naturally aid in beak maintenance, as puffer fish can develop overgrown beaks if not provided with the appropriate food.
